Pasco reported 10 dog attacks on mail carriers in 2022 

June 6, 2023
TCAJOB Staff

Pasco came in just behind Seattle and Spokane for the number of dog attacks on mail carriers. 

There were 10 dog attacks on Pasco mail carriers in 2022, compared to Seattle and Spokane, which each recorded 13 attacks, according to recently released data from the U.S. Postal Service.

Franklin PUD lands $4.9 million for broadband project

May 19, 2023
TCAJOB Staff

Franklin PUD is one of several agencies sharing in $121 million in grant dollars to deliver high-speed internet access to unserved and underserved communities around the state. 

The Washington State Broadband Office announced the grants on May 16.
